Transaction 21951e62ffd19081ef65ce41ace24083ea4349672a70ded5e7a4c1b5b80d672e

1 Input
2 Outputs
  • 21951e62ffd19081ef65ce41ace24083ea4349672a70ded5e7a4c1b5b80d672e:0
  • value  421018
    address  1FKx9JxexyBE6B4miAqJbrrCXgf3LvunXf
  • 21951e62ffd19081ef65ce41ace24083ea4349672a70ded5e7a4c1b5b80d672e:1
  • value  1344213
    address  3E9UTgpnugxmzVTc2z7XExrwR6ZR7mhS1x